 Worship Services  

WORSHIP . . . provides opportunities to touch heaven and be touched by God. Every individual has been created with a God-shaped hole deep inside that only God can fill. Inspiring, lively music and worship, accompanied by engaging biblical preaching, special features, meaningful rituals, and heartfelt prayer enable participants to regularly come into the presence of God. Several gifted worship teams take turns in leading each Sunday, regularly guiding worshippers into the presence of God to be touched by Him.

When one thinks of worship like a stage production, we understand that the worship team are the prompters, the congregation are the actors and God is the audience. When we come to worship, we do not come to be entertained and act as critics of those up front! Rather, we come to worship with our whole being and God is the one who judges the quality of our worship. Our desire is that each Sunday God would be pleased and blessed by what we offer up to Him!

  • Let your hungry heart experience this on Sunday mornings, from 10:00 a.m. to 11:30 a.m. as the English-speaking congregation comes together to worship.

  • The Punjabi Christian Centre gathers to worship in the downstairs chapel Sunday mornings, from 10:00 a.m. to 11:30 a.m. This service is conducted primarily in the Punjabi language.

  • A friendly time of visiting over coffee or juice follows the worship services at approximately 11:30 a.m. This is a great time to get acquainted with worshippers from both congregations.  

MESSAGE . . . we believe a person can find joy and meaning in life, and a right relationship with God through Jesus Christ. It’s really true! The messages each Sunday, whether by one of our pastors or an occasional guest, always seek to communicate this positive, uplifting message. Let God’s Word, the Bible – His love letter to us, speak to the realities of your life and its challenges.  Most messages are made available for listening to on our website at: http://bearcreekcc.org/audio.htm

SEASONAL SPECIALS . . . A variety of seasonal services or events are held in the course of each year. Some of these include:

  •  In the past "Christmas" Pudding was an annual "sold out" dessert/drama presentation. This is still done from time to time. Stay tuned for more information and future dates for this event.

  • Christmas Eve – a candlelight service including communion on the eve of the celebration of Christ’s birth, held at 6:30 pm.

  • Good Friday – a 10:00 a.m. service, unique every year, remembering the suffering and death of our Lord Jesus Christ, and commemorated with the Lord’s Supper celebration.

  • Easter Celebration & Baptism Service – which usually includes a good group of baptismal candidates who are ready to publicly take their stand for Jesus Christ as their Savior and Lord.

  • Christmas Banquet, Valentine’s Banquet, Spring or Fall Baptisms, Summer BBQ/Picnics in our Church Park, Fall Ministry Fair . . . these are just some of the other extra special events that are held in the course of the year.
